Caps United coach Lloyd Chitembwe delighted with win over Dynamos

CAPS United coach Lloyd Chitembwe was a happy man after seeing his charges break a 7 year jinx to beat City rivals Dynamos yesterday in a Premiership encounter.

Caps beat Dynamos 1-0 courtesy of a Dominic Chungwa’s second half strike.

Chitembwe who incidentally was the last coach to beat Dynamos back in 2009 alluded the victory to team work and quality of players at their disposal.

“It definitely feels good to win, I am happy for the boys they showed great tenacity, Chitembwe said after the match.

“The win is good for confidence and belief.

Caps United came from the break a much stronger team in what Chitembwe believes its the depth of the team.

“At the end of the day the difference for me was quality. When you look at our squad like when Archford (Gutu) came in he gave us another dimension and when Simba (Nhivi) also came in again he gave us another dimension. So the difference for me was quality.” he added.
